The following obituary appeared in "The Altoona Mirror" (Altoona, PA) on November 23, 2013:

W.R. "Dick" Bortz, 85, Wernersville, formerly of Altoona, passed away Thursday, Nov. 21, 2013, at ManorCare Health Services-Sinking Spring.

He was born in West Reading, son of the late Walter A. and Alva A. (Berstler) Bortz.

Surviving are his wife, Janet M. (Nelson); two sons: Richard A. of Mechanicsburg and Jeffrey N. of Allentown; a daughter, Lori Ann Sullivan of Fairless Hills; and seven grandchildren.

He was preceded in death by a sister, Fern I. Yoder; and a brother, George.

Dick was a graduate of Mount Penn High School and a veteran of the U.S. Army, serving in the Korean War. He worked for 37 years with Bell Telephone and AT&T. He was a member of West Lawn United Methodist Church and was a life member of the Lower Alsace Fire Company, Lower Heidelberg Township Volunteer Fire Department and Berks County Firemen's Association. He was past president of the Altoona, Susquehanna Township and Reading Pagoda Lions Clubs with 33 years of perfect attendance.

Dick was a Master Mason of Juniata Lodge 282, Hollidaysburg, and a 32nd-degree Mason of the Valley of Altoona, Ancient Accepted Scottish Rite. He was also a member of the Jaffa Shrine of Altoona, Rajah Shrine of Reading, and Ancient Arabic Order of the Nobles of the Mystic Shrine and past president of the Rajah String Band. He was a board member and drive coordinator of Shriners Hospital in Philadelphia and past president of High Twelve. He was also a board member of the Miss Pennsylvania pageant and a member of the Telephone Pioneers of America.
